    I recently purchased these lamps at a local estate sale, I don't know any history on it, however, I just thought they were stunning. They are about 36" tall, with double bowls, and double rows of 12 glass prisms each.

    I would love to have any insight as to what kind of lampa these are, and the age of them????

      From the base 1960's to the 1970's likely. Have seen hundreds over the years, some nice, some not. They used a higher quality prism on these. Sometimes the base would light up also and had a metal mesh shaped diffuser for the base lights which were very nice, and trilight switches with them. Many examples on ebay and google. Have done some research on them but most were unmarked or marked on bottom.
